Embodiment 2

[0012] Embodiment 2 The working process of the electrical automatic control system of a pneumatic conveying system for soybeans:

[0013] The industrial control computer or DCS system 2 uses the PLC programmable control system 1 to measure the data through the load cell 19 and the mass flow meter 20 according to the material-gas ratio. The compressed air with the set pressure value of the pressure valve 5 discharges the soybeans added from the material hopper into the outlet of the warehouse pump through the pneumatic discharge valve 10, and transports them to the material pipeline. According to the process and production needs, the soybeans are distributed into the warehouse by the pneumatic switching valve 12 , The high-level material level gauge 13 and the low-level material level gauge 15 are installed on the silo for controlling the material level of the silo. Abstract

The invention relates to an automatic electric control system of a soybean pneumatic transportation system. The automatic electric control system comprises a PLC system 1, an industrial computer or DCS system 2, an air compressor and refrigeration dryer motor 3, an electric contact pressure gauge 4, a pressure regulating valve 5, a pneumatic exhaust valve 6, a pressure transmitter 7, a feeding valve 8, a pneumatic pre-closing valve 9, a pneumatic discharging valve 10, a high level meter 11, a pneumatic converter valve 12, a high level meter 13, a pressure relief valve 14, a low level meter 15, a pneumatic plug valve 16, a signal transmission cable 17, a pulse pneumatic knife-edge valve 18, a weighing sensor 19 and a mass and flow meter 20. The automatic electric control system is characterized in that the automatic electric control system is controlled by the PLC system 1 integrally, the material-air ratio ranges from 42 to 45, and the system adjusts pipeline equipment according to the material-air ratio. The automatic electric control system has the advantages that the control process is relative to relevant component actions, and actions are executed automatically; the material-air ratio optimization control is guaranteed during transportation, the compressed air is saved, and the operation cost is reduced.
